In Romania, the first durable, professional engineering association, was founded in 1881, under the name of Polytechnical Society. The Romanian General Association of Engineers was founded in 1918. Both associations coexisted until they merged in 1949. Then followed a period when the resulting organisation had different names.

In 1989, the Romanian General Association of Engineers, a professional, non-governmental, non-political, non-profit making association under supervision of the Law n° 21/1924, has been reconstituted as a lawful successor of the original associations. It is an open organisation, its members are engineers with recognised title, having the rights and obligations defined by its Statutes, without distinction of speciality, sex, nationality, ethnic, political or religious belonging.

The Romanian General Association of Engineers is a National member of the World Federation of Engineering Organisations (WFEO) and cooperates with many regional and international engineering organisations.

Structure

AGIR has a federal structure, comprising 28 territorial branches and 12 speciality-based associations. The supreme leading authority is the Congress, which is normally convened every four years. The Council, the members of which are elected by the Congress, convenes in plenary sessions at least twice a year. The 15-member Executive committee of the Council and the technical and administrative staff provide for the effective management of the association.

AGIR is financially independent and receives no governmental or other grants. Its financial basis is made of individual and collective member fees as well as income from the association’s real estate.

AGIR’s bimonthly publication "Engineering Universe" contains information about the internal and international technical and scientific information. It is sent free to all members. Other publications include the "AGIR Bulletin" which appears quarterly and the "AGIR Yearbook".
